Responsibilities
Collaborate with software developers and electrical engineers to write documentation and software to integrate with external data acquisition devices.
Utilize test driven development, dependency injection and the notion of domain driven design to craft production quality reliable code.
Participate in the Agile process.

Required
BS Degree and 8+ years of experience or Masters Degree with 6+ years experience. May consider additional experience in lieu of a degree.
Must have the ability to obtain a Public Trust clearance (US citizenship required).
Must have a strong programming background with production product development experience in C# or Java.
Must have strong object oriented design skills (OOD); knowledge and experience using Design Patterns and object oriented design principals is highly desired.
Must be open to using XP practices and following an Agile process.
Must be able to create design documentation, requirements specifications, and other technical documentation.
Must have strong troubleshooting/bug fixing skills.
You must be able to work and communicate proactively and effectively in a small cross-functional development team environment.
Working knowledge and experience in C-Sharp 8.0, Dot net framework 4.8, Test driven development and unit test suites, Domain driven design, IPv4 networking, Kubernetes, Containers, Microsoft SQL Server – Transact SQL, Visual Studio 2019, 2022, ReSharper, Windows Presentation Foundation, RabbitMQ – Advanced Message Queuing Protocol, Agile development process.
Preferred
Experience with XP practices, particularly TDD using xUnit or some derivative. Familiarity with OO design patterns, design of loosely coupled extensible architectures, n-tier development. Experience identifying code smells and utilizing refactoring techniques to reduce entropy in the code base. Experience with a documented form of design such as UML. Experience with revision control (e.g. Subversion) and Agile software process experience (i.e. SCRUM).
Multi-threading experience is also highly desirable. Interfacing with real-time systems. Image processing background is strongly desired.
